Understanding the Importance of Using the Right Oil

If you own a Toro lawn mower, it’s crucial to use the right type of oil to keep it running smoothly and efficiently. Using the correct oil will ensure that your mower’s engine stays properly lubricated, which helps to reduce friction and prevent damage. So, what oil does a Toro lawn mower take? Toro recommends using SAE 30 weight oil for their push mower models.

It’s essential to check your owner’s manual or the sticker on your mower’s engine for specific recommendations, as different Toro models may require different types of oil. Using the wrong oil can lead to engine malfunction or even permanent damage, so it’s essential to follow the manufacturer’s guidelines. Recommended Toro Lawn Mower Oils

If you’re wondering what oil does a Toro lawn mower take, you’re in the right place. Toro lawn mowers generally recommend using a high-quality SAE 30 motor oil for optimal performance and protection. This type of oil is specifically formulated for small engines like those found in lawn mowers.

It provides excellent lubrication and helps to reduce wear and tear on the engine. Additionally, some Toro models may require Synthetic SAE 5W-30 oil, which offers enhanced performance in extreme temperatures. It’s always a good idea to consult your Toro lawn mower manual or contact Toro customer service for specific oil recommendations for your particular model.

Choosing the right oil based on your Toro lawn mower model

Toro lawn mowers are known for their durability and high performance, but in order to keep them running smoothly, you need to choose the right oil. Different models of Toro lawn mowers have different oil requirements, so it’s important to consult your owner’s manual or contact the manufacturer to find out which type of oil is recommended for your specific model. Some common Toro lawn mower oils include SAE 30, 10W-30, and synthetic oils.

SAE 30 is typically used in warmer climates, while 10W-30 is suitable for a wider range of temperatures. Synthetic oils are a great option for those who want maximum protection and performance. Remember to check the oil level regularly and change it according to the manufacturer’s recommendations to keep your Toro lawn mower running smoothly season after season.

Steps to Change the Oil in Your Toro Lawn Mower

If you own a Toro lawn mower, it’s important to know what kind of oil your mower takes to keep it running smoothly. The specific oil type will depend on the model of your Toro mower, so it’s always best to consult the owner’s manual for the correct information. Most Toro lawn mowers require a SAE 30 oil, which is a common type of motor oil used in small engines.

This type of oil provides the necessary lubrication and protection to ensure your mower’s engine runs at its best. Changing the oil in your Toro lawn mower is a relatively simple task that you can do yourself. First, make sure to position your mower on a flat surface and disconnect the spark plug wire to prevent any accidental starting.

Drain the old oil by locating the drain plug underneath the mower and using a wrench or pliers to remove it. Be sure to have a drain pan or container to catch the oil. Once the old oil has drained completely, replace the drain plug and refill the engine with the recommended amount of new oil.

It’s important to use the correct amount of oil, as over or underfilling can impact the mower’s performance. Finally, reconnect the spark plug wire and start up your Toro lawn mower to ensure everything is working properly. Regularly changing the oil in your Toro lawn mower is an essential part of maintenance to keep it running efficiently and extend its lifespan.

How often should I change the oil in my Toro lawn mower?

Toro lawn mowers are popular for their durability and reliability, but just like any other machine, they require regular maintenance to keep them running smoothly. One common question that Toro lawn mower owners often have is how often they should change the oil in their mower. The answer to this question depends on a few factors, such as how often you use your mower and the type of oil you are using.

As a general rule of thumb, it is recommended to change the oil in your Toro lawn mower every 25-50 hours of use or at least once a season. This will help to ensure that the engine stays lubricated and free from dirt and debris. It’s important to note that using the right type of oil is crucial for optimal performance.

Toro recommends using SAE 30 weight oil for their lawn mowers, but it’s always a good idea to consult the owner’s manual for your specific model for the manufacturer’s recommendations. By regularly changing the oil in your Toro lawn mower, you can extend its lifespan and keep it running smoothly for years to come.

FAQs

What type of oil should I use for my Toro lawn mower?
Toro recommends using SAE 30 weight oil for their lawn mowers.

Can I use synthetic oil in my Toro lawn mower?
Yes, you can use synthetic oil in your Toro lawn mower. Just make sure it meets the recommended viscosity and is compatible with your engine.

How often should I change the oil in my Toro lawn mower?
It is recommended to change the oil in your Toro lawn mower every 25-50 hours of use or at least once a year.

What happens if I use the wrong oil in my Toro lawn mower?
Using the wrong oil in your Toro lawn mower can lead to poor performance, increased engine wear, and potential engine damage. It is important to use the recommended oil to ensure proper lubrication and protection.

Is it necessary to use Toro brand oil in my lawn mower?
While Toro recommends using their brand of oil, you can use other reputable brands that meet the recommended specifications. Just make sure the oil you choose is appropriate for small engines.

Can I mix different brands of oil in my Toro lawn mower?
It is not recommended to mix different brands of oil in your Toro lawn mower. Stick to using one brand and ensure it meets the recommended specifications for your engine.

How much oil does a Toro lawn mower hold?
The oil capacity of a Toro lawn mower can vary depending on the model. It is important to refer to the owner’s manual or check the manufacturer’s website for the specific oil capacity of your mower.

What are the signs that my Toro lawn mower needs an oil change? A8. Some signs that your Toro lawn mower may need an oil change include increased engine noise, a drop in performance, smoking or overheating, and a dark or dirty appearance of the oil.

Can I use multi-viscosity oil in my Toro lawn mower?
Yes, you can use multi-viscosity oil in your Toro lawn mower. Just make sure it meets the recommended viscosity range for your specific model.

Should I change the oil in my Toro lawn mower before storing it for the winter?
It is recommended to change the oil in your Toro lawn mower before storing it for the winter. This helps to prevent any contaminants or moisture from causing damage to the engine during the off-season.

Can I reuse the oil from my Toro lawn mower?
It is not recommended to reuse the oil from your Toro lawn mower. Used oil may contain contaminants that can harm the engine if reused. It is best to properly dispose of the used oil and refill with fresh oil.

What are the benefits of using high-quality oil in my Toro lawn mower?
Using high-quality oil in your Toro lawn mower can provide better engine protection, improved performance, and extended engine life. It helps to reduce friction, keep the engine clean, and provide proper lubrication for all moving parts.
